Subject: [PATCH] cpu_x86: Turn virCPUx86DataIteratorInit into a function
|
|
MIME-Version: 1.0
|
|
Content-Type: text/plain; charset=UTF-8
|
|
Content-Transfer-Encoding: 8bit
|
|
|
|
Until now, this was a macro usable for direct initialization when a
|
|
variable is defined. Turning the macro into a function makes it more
|
|
general.
